Monica Denise Arnold, an American businesswoman, rapper, actress, songwriter, and singer, is known for her successful musical career. She signed with Rowdy Records in 1993 and released her debut album “Miss Thang” two years later, which marked the beginning of her successful journey. In this article, we will discuss Monica’s net worth, early life, career achievements, personal life, and more.

Early Life

Monica Arnold was born on October 24, 1980, in Oak Park, Georgia, to Marilyn Best, a church singer and airline customer service representative, and M.C. “Billy” Arnold, Jr., a mechanic. At the age of four, she began singing in her local church choir. Despite her rough work schedule, Best was also devoted to her church and choir and passed on that love of gospel music to her daughter. Growing up in College Park, Georgia—a suburb of Atlanta—Monica began singing in the church choir alongside her mother when she was just a toddler. Her parents divorced in 1987.

Career Achievements

Monica’s first album, “Miss Thang,” was a hit, and she followed it up with a chain of successful albums such as “The Boy is Mine” and “After the Storm.” She also had several successful single hits like “Angel of Mine” and “Everything To Me,” which made their place as No. 1 in pop and R&B charts. Her work in films such as “Boys and Girls” (2000), “Pastor Brown” (2006), and “Love Song” (2000) was also much appreciated. Her work in television series like “Living Single” (1996) and “American Dreams”(2003) was also highly acclaimed. She even received the Grammy Award for Best R&B duo with vocal (with Brandy), Recording Academy, for “The Boy is Mine,” in 1998.

Monica’s work in the music industry has made her one of the most popular and successful R&B artists in the history of music. Her albums have sold over 25 million copies worldwide, and she has received several awards, including Grammys, Billboards, and many others.

Personal Life

Monica was married to Shannon Brown, an NBA player, on November 22, 2010, and they had three children together, Rodney Ramone Hill III, Romelo Montez Hill, and Laiyah Shannon Brown. The couple got divorced in October 2019 after eight years of marriage.
